Total Student Population Comparison

The total student population of selected colleges is 51,165 with 31,252 female students and 19,913 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, California State University-Fresno has the most enrolled students of 23,999, while Shasta College has the least number of students of 7,363 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.

Distance Learning (Online Class) Enrollment

The following table compares 2022-2023 distance learning enrollment for both undergraduate and graduate programs between selected colleges. In undergraduate programs, out of total 45,751 students, 5,543 students (12.12%) have taken courses only through distance learning and 24,208 students (52.91%) have learned from at least one online course. For graduate schools, out of total 5,414 students, 758 students (14.00%) have taken courses only through distance learning and 2,140 students (39.53%) have learned from at least one online course.
